How do I calculate the right length of heating cable needed for my Wisconsin property?

When it comes to ensuring warmth and comfort in your Wisconsin property during the cold winter months, one important consideration is determining the correct length of heating cable needed. Calculating the appropriate length is crucial to effectively heat the desired areas and avoid any unnecessary costs or inefficiencies.

The first step is to assess the area that needs to be heated. Measure the length and width of each room or space where you plan to install the heating cable. Multiply these dimensions together to obtain the square footage of each area. Additionally, consider any areas that may require extra heating, such as entryways, bathrooms, or basements.

Next, take into account the heat loss factors of your property. Factors such as insulation levels, exposure to the elements, and the type of construction materials can all impact the amount of heat needed. A higher heat loss may require a longer heating cable to maintain the desired temperature.

It's also important to determine the wattage or power requirements of the heating cable. Different types and brands may have varying wattage per foot or meter. Divide the total wattage needed by the wattage per unit length of the heating cable to get an estimate of the required length.

In addition to these factors, it's advisable to consult with a professional heating contractor or an expert in the field. They can provide more specific guidance based on the unique characteristics of your property and help ensure that you select the right heating cable and calculate the appropriate length.

Remember, accurately calculating the length of heating cable is an essential step in creating a cozy and efficient heating system for your Wisconsin home. By taking the time to assess the various factors and seeking professional advice when needed, you can make informed decisions and enjoy a warm and comfortable living environment throughout the winter season.
